Tuition & Fees for 2025-2026
Preschool | 3 Days (M,W,F)
$10,910
Tuition ($10,410) + Registration Fee* ($500)
Preschool | 5 Days
$18,150
Tuition ($17,650) + Registration Fee* ($500)
Developmental Kindergarten - Grade 2
$26,430
Tuition ($25,430) + Registration Fee* ($1,000)
Grade 3 - Grade 6
$27,340
Tuition ($26,340) + Registration Fee* ($1,000)

Tuition Assistance
Saint Mark’s is committed to making its education accessible to qualified students, regardless of financial circumstances. Each year, a portion of the school’s operating budget is dedicated to bridging the gap between family resources and the cost of tuition. Tuition assistance is available at all grade levels, including preschool, and currently supports approximately 30% of our students. Awards range from $1,000 to nearly full tuition, with an average award covering over 50% of tuition costs.

There is a $65 application fee. New families and those with siblings at other Clarity schools can share their application with additional participating schools at no extra cost by using the dropdown menu in the application.
Tax information from your 2024 filings will transfer automatically from the IRS during the verification step. The deadline to complete the application and submit all required documents is December 19, 2025 for current Saint Mark’s families and January 19, 2026 for new applicants.
